Seroepidemiologic Study of Oropouche Virus, Amazonas State, Brazil, 2015-2016. [PDF]
We conducted a cross-sectional serosurvey for Oropouche virus (OROV) among residents of Amazonas State, Brazil, during 2015–2016. We detected OROV neutralizing antibodies in 85/814 (10.4%) participants; seroprevalence was higher in Manaus (49/440 [11.1%]

Oropouche Virus (OROV) is a segmented RNA arbovirus belonging to the Orthobunyavirus genus within the Peribunyaviridae family and classified within the Simbu serogroup. It is the etiological agent of the zoonotic disease known as Oropouche Fever. This acute disease ranks second after dengue in cases of febrile syndrome.

Here we report the acute and post-acute virological findings in a OROV infected traveller returning to Italy from Cuba. Testing multiple specimen types and the prolonged detection of OROV RNA in whole blood and urine samples extend the possibility of cases confirmation through direct diagnosis even in convalescence-phase of infection.

Oropouche virus (OROV) is an orthobunyavirus endemic in the Brazilian Amazon that has caused numerous outbreaks of febrile disease since its discovery in 1955. During 2024, Oropouche fever spread from the endemic regions of Brazil into non-endemic areas and other Latin American and Caribbean countries, resulting in 13,014 confirmed infections ...
